The Carson City Library kicked off their annual reading challenge Saturday with the theme of “All around the World.”

The fun continues until 4 PM.

Readers and attendees can find games, prizes, and areas dedicated to various international themes.

Try your hand at cattle roping, air balloon races, penguin bowling, tossing a ring in the top of the Eiffel Tower, and so much more!

For more information head on down to the Carson City Library located at 900 N. Roop Street.
